Bonnie Rattunde Zak Obituary

Bonnie Jean (Rattunde) Zak, age 90 of New Lisbon formerly of Necedah, passed away peacefully at Crest View Nursing home, Monday evening, April 2, 2018 while surrounded by family.  Bonnie was born October 24, 1927 to Harold and Dorothy (Tucker) Oakes. 

In Bonnie’s younger years she was a certified lifeguard in New Lisbon and also graduated from Juneau County Normal Teachers College, after which she taught school in Necedah and also taught special needs children in Mauston.  Bonnie married Marland “Mike” Rattunde in October 1949 and was blessed with five children.  After Marland’s death on April 21st, 1984, Bonnie was married to Clayton Ritchart in October of 1985, and after his death was married to William “Bill” Zak on February 11, 1996. 

After raising her five children she returned to work as a Homemaker for the Juneau County Social Service Department until her retirement.  She had also worked as a part-time matron for the Juneau County Sheriff’s Department.  The closest thing to Bonnie’s heart was her volunteer work.

She was a member of the Eastern Star for over 50 years and was a past Worthy Matron twice.  She was a lifetime member of the American Legion Auxiliary, past Queen Mother of the Red Hat Society, President of the Methodist Church, past Necedah Citizen of the year, Lioness for New Lisbon and Necedah, and Past President of the Juneau County Extension Homemakers.
